课件15张PPT。1Myths,traditions and opinionsGrammar3PetsCONTENTS PAGEPassive voice (II)Using adverbsPassive voice (II)3-1123Passive forms with modal verbs are made from a modal verb + be + the past participle form of the main verb.People should be allowed to have pet dogs. Jack may write articles about pets.The task must be completed by Alice today.The invitation should be sent to Mr Li by us.The problem cannot be solved by them.Articles about pets may be written by Jack.Using adverbs7-1123Some adverbs tell us how people do things. We usually make these adverbs by adding –ly to adjectives.A dog will love you faithfully for many years.Some words can be used as both adjectives and adverbs, e.g., hard, fast, early, late.
Good is an adjective; its adverbial form is well.4567 A man called Happy keeps a pet shop. But today Happy is not happy! He is thinking …B17-21234567 This is what Happy says to his staff.
